Pathogenesis and Therapeutic Challenges in Eisenmenger Syndrome
Eisenmenger syndrome arises from congenital heart defects that lead to abnormal blood flow patterns, resulting in pulmonary hypertension. This increased pressure in the pulmonary arteries damages the lungs, kalp, ve diğer organlar. Conventional therapies, including pulmonary vasodilators and heart-lung transplantation, have limitations and often fail to halt the disease’s progression.
